On this trailblazing episode, reporter and historian Robert Nott drops by to discuss Sam Peckinpah's Ride the High Country. Robert is the author of several acclaimed books on Western film history, including The Films of Randolph Scott, Last of the Cowboy Heroes, The Films of Budd Boetticher, and Goin' Crazy with Sam Peckinpah and All Our Friends. His latest book is titled Ride the High Country, and it's the first book to focus exclusively on Peckinpah's poignant 1962 classic.

Robert Nott's book, Ride the High Country, is published by the University of New Mexico Press, and is part of the Reel West series, edited by Andrew Patrick Nelson.
